LockBit's claim of fresh ransomware payments denied
Briefly

LockBit quickly set up a new website and updated it with a list of forthcoming victim ransom deadlines - one of which included data allegedly stolen from Fulton County, Georgia.
Brett Callow, threat analyst with Emsisoft, suggested that rather than the ransom getting paid, it's more likely whatever data LockBit may have had on Fulton County or Donald Trump was seized by law enforcement earlier this month.
